Tex. Fin. Code Section 95.003
Investment in Accounts


(a)

Any person may be the holder of a deposit account.

(b)

An investment in a deposit account may be made only in cash.

(c)

A person may invest in a deposit account in the person’s own right or in a trust or other fiduciary capacity.
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 1008,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
